Transaction 1590729bf96a8da017e950368ad16189dd33251809429570670a88fcf7f7ad98

1 Input
2 Outputs
  • 1590729bf96a8da017e950368ad16189dd33251809429570670a88fcf7f7ad98:0
  • value  33000
    address  3FxTTrLAhSsZHyXkajG4kLo5V26i5G15nQ
  • 1590729bf96a8da017e950368ad16189dd33251809429570670a88fcf7f7ad98:1
  • value  1528653
    address  1vKL4DXoWadESg1UEKKreT9ZFWKdZ9wCf